Operations Supervisor jobs in Huntsville, AL

Operations Supervisor supervises the daily activities of an operational unit. Monitors and assists staff to maintain workflow and achieve targeted operational and financial results. Being an Operations Supervisor implements practices to ensure compliance with operational policies and procedures. Resolves routine operational issues and escalates complex issues as needed. Additionally, Operations Supervisor prepares performance and progress reports for management to monitor and improve inefficiencies. May require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ager. The Operations Supervisor supervises a small group of para-professional staff in an organization characterized by highly transactional or repetitive processes. Contributes to the development of processes and procedures. To be an Operations Supervisor typically requires 3 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. Thorough knowledge of functional area under supervision.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

  • Title: Operations Supervisor
    Department: Operations
    Reports to: Assistant General Manager
    Subordinates: Line Level Associates and Department Heads

    SUMMARY: The purpose of an Operations Supervisor is to support executing the day-to-day sales operations of the hotel, and assisting the Assistant General Manager in supervising the guest relations, reservation management, restaurant operation activities, front desk, housekeeping in accordance with hotel policies and procedures keeping with the direction of the management team in efforts to uphold the culture of McNeill Hotel Company.

    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ITES:

    • Opens and closes Front Desk shifts / Housekeeping and ensuring completion of assigned shift checklist and other duties.
    • Runs and reviews critical information contained in room operations reports.
    • Understands the functions of the Recreation. Laundry, Housekeeping, Bell Staff, AYS,
    • Operates all department equipment as necessary and reporting malfunctions.
    • Ensures employees have the proper supplies and uniforms.
    • Understands night audit procedures and being able to comprehend and utilize reports as necessary.
    • Understands and complies with loss prevention policies and procedures.
    • Communicates performance expectations employees in accordance with job descriptions for each position.
    • Handles employee questions and concerns.
    • Effectively schedules employees to business demands and tracks employee time and attendance.
    • Supervises same day selling procedures to maximize room revenue and property occupancy.
    • Verifies accuracy of room rates to maximize revenue opportunities
    • Uses budgets, operating statements and payroll progress reports as needed to assist in the management of the Room Operations.
    • Participates in the management of departmental controllable expenses to achieve or exceed budgeted goals.
    • Understands the impact of Room Operations on the overall property financial goals and objectives.
    • Assists in the investigation of employee and guest accidents.
    • Assists in the use of a guest information tracking system to ensure that a successful repeat guest recognition program is in use to recognize guest preferences and
    • Sets a positive example for guest relations.
    • Interacts with guests to obtain feedback on product quality and service levels; effectively responding to and handles guest problems and complaints seeking assistance from supervisor as necessary.
    • Assists in the review of comment cards and guest satisfaction results with employees

Huntsville is a city located primarily in Madison County in the Appalachian region of northern Alabama. Huntsville is the county seat of Madison County. The city extends west into neighboring Limestone County and south into Morgan County. Huntsville's population was 180,105 as of the 2010 census. Huntsville is the third-largest city in Alabama and the largest city in the five-county Huntsville-Decatur-Albertville, AL Combined Statistical Area, which at the 2013 census estimate had a total population of 683,871.
